Jay Idzes Under Scrutiny After Sassuolo Defeat to Bologna
Published: March 21, 2026
REggio Emilia, Italy – Sassuolo captain and Indonesian national team mainstay Jay Idzes is facing criticism from Italian media following his side’s narrow 1-0 defeat to Bologna in Serie A on March 15, 2026. The loss at the Mapei Stadium – Città del Tricolore extends a concerning trend for Sassuolo, who have now conceded early goals in consecutive league matches.
Despite a competitive showing and holding a significant share of possession, Sassuolo were undone by a swift counter-attack and a 13th-minute goal from Bologna’s Thijs Dallinga. The focus of post-match analysis quickly turned to Idzes’ role in the build-up to the decisive goal, with some observers suggesting he was slow to react to the danger.
Early Goal Proves Decisive
The match began poorly for the hosts, as Bologna capitalized on an early opportunity. Riccardo Orsolini’s run down the right flank created space, and after a shot from Jens Odgaard was blocked, the ball fell favorably for Dallinga inside the penalty area. The Dutch striker was able to capitalize on the opportunity, slotting the ball past the Sassuolo goalkeeper.
According to reports from Sassuolo News, Idzes was directly implicated in the goal. “Jay Idzes was careless and gave too much space to Dallinga to turn and shoot when the score was 0-1,” the outlet wrote. The criticism highlights the intense scrutiny faced by players in Serie A, where even minor lapses in concentration can prove costly.
Idzes’ Overall Performance: A Mixed Bag
While the focus on the goal conceded is understandable, a closer look at Idzes’ overall performance reveals a more nuanced picture. The Indonesian captain played the full 90 minutes and contributed significantly to Sassuolo’s defensive efforts. He registered 58 touches on the ball and made 10 defensive actions, including two tackles, two blocks, four clearances, two interceptions, and five recoveries.
These statistics earned Idzes a rating of 6.8, which is considered a stable score for a central defender. He also made several key interventions, including blocking a shot that could have extended Bologna’s lead. The performance, while not flawless, demonstrates Idzes’ continued importance to the Sassuolo squad.
Sassuolo’s Struggles Continue
The defeat leaves Sassuolo in 10th place in the Serie A standings with 38 points. The league is proving to be highly competitive this season, with a tiny margin separating teams in the mid-table. This loss underscores the challenges Sassuolo faces as they attempt to climb the table and secure a European qualification spot.
Jay Idzes, who was naturalized as an Indonesian citizen in 2024, has become a key figure for both club and country. He debuted for the Indonesian national team in 2024, earning 16 caps and scoring one goal as of October 14, 2025, according to Wikipedia. His leadership and defensive capabilities are highly valued by both sets of supporters.
